ASME SA213 TP347H Seamless Tube Austenitic Stainless Steel Heat Exchanger & Boiler Tube
High-Temperature & Corrosion-Resistant Tubing for Critical Applications
ASTM A213 TP347H is a seamless, austenitic stainless steel tube specifically engineered for high-temperature service in demanding environments. Designated as a heat-resistant grade (indicated by the "H"), it delivers superior creep-rupture strength compared to its non-H counterparts, making it a reliable choice for pressure-bound applications.
This grade belongs to the niobium-stabilized Cr-Ni austenitic family. The addition of niobium (Nb) significantly enhances its resistance to intergranular corrosion, particularly in environments containing acids, alkalis, and salts. It offers better high-temperature strength and oxidation resistance than standard Type 316 stainless steel.
Primary Standards & Specifications
- Governing Standard: ASTM A213/A213M - Specification for Seamless Ferritic and Austenitic Alloy-Steel Boiler, Superheater, and Heat-Exchanger Tubes
- Common Size Range: Outside diameter from 3.2 mm (1/8 in) to 127 mm (5 in) with minimum wall thickness ranging from 0.4 mm to 12.7 mm
- Manufacturing Process: Seamless, available in hot-finished or cold-finished conditions
Material & Chemical Composition
TP347H is a high-carbon, niobium-stabilized austenitic stainless steel. The chemical composition ensures stability and strength under thermal stress.
| Element | Composition Range (%) | Key Function |
|---|---|---|
| Carbon (C) | 0.04 - 0.10 | Enhances high-temperature strength |
| Manganese (Mn) | ≤ 2.00 | Improves hot ductility and strength |
| Silicon (Si) | ≤ 1.00 | Deoxidizer that improves oxidation resistance |
| Phosphorus (P) | ≤ 0.045 | Impurity element, controlled to low levels |
| Sulfur (S) | ≤ 0.030 | Impurity element, controlled to low levels |
| Chromium (Cr) | 17.00 - 19.00 | Provides fundamental corrosion and oxidation resistance |
| Nickel (Ni) | 9.00 - 13.00 | Stabilizes the austenitic structure and improves toughness |
| Niobium (Nb) | 0.80 - 1.00 (or 8xC min) | Critical Element. Forms stable carbides to prevent chromium depletion at grain boundaries, granting exceptional resistance to intergranular corrosion |
Mechanical & Physical Properties
TP347H offers a robust combination of strength, ductility, and stability for high-temperature operations.
| Property | Standard Requirement |
|---|---|
| Tensile Strength | ≥ 515 MPa (75 ksi) |
| Yield Strength (0.2% Offset) | ≥ 205 MPa (30 ksi) |
| Elongation (A5) | ≥ 35% |
| Hardness (Brinell) | ≤ 192 HB |
Main Application Scenarios
Thanks to its high-temperature strength, oxidation resistance, and corrosion stability, ASTM A213 TP347H tubes are the material of choice for critical components in several heavy industries:
- Power Generation: Superheater and reheater tubes, main steam lines, and high-pressure boiler tubing in fossil fuel and thermal power plants
- Petrochemical & Chemical Processing: Heat exchanger tubes, reactor internals, and piping systems that handle corrosive media at elevated temperatures
- Oil & Gas Refining: Tubing for refinery heaters, heat recovery systems, and other high-temperature processing units
- Other Industries: Also finds application in synthetic fiber, food, and paper industries where similar corrosion and temperature challenges exist
